The Red Banker HouseThe house of employees of the State Bank of the USSR called Red Banker (now it is Alchevskikh street, 6)t was built in 1928 by civil engineer V. Estrovych. It is an eclectic building with features of Ukrainian architecture, baroque, and modernism. This brick building is sectional, five-storied with a basement. The closeness to other buildings and the desire to make the most of its plot have led to a rather complex configuration of the architectural volume of the object. This residential dwelling is sandwiched between tall buildings, stretched deep into the quarter and H-shaped. The narrow building plot was compensated by the cour d'honneur looking at Alchevskych street. The doorways of four sections of the house, consisting of 2, 3, and 4-room apartments, pass into the cour d'honneur. On the axis of it there is an arched passage to the yard. Architect and art critic G. Lebedev wrote that it was the unfavorable location of the building and the complexity of its volume configuration that forced the architect to apply various methods of apartment planning and to use numerous protrusions and ledges of it. But all this only partially allowed to create equal living conditions - some apartments still have not convenient planning, proper insulation, and aeration. The symmetrical facade is characterized by the plasticity of bay windows and balconies, a picturesque outline of roofs with gables and turrets. The motifs of the Renaissance, Gothic (arrow windows), Baroque (curved gables, roof hall), and the modernist way of its interpretation are intertwined. The tile-covered course belt between the fourth and fifth floors reminiscent of typical Ukrainian wooden church elements. In 1949, the architect O. Kasyanov wrote on this: “Fascinated by the study of traditional Ukrainian architecture, the architect tried to give the building distinctive national features. However, he did not fully succeed; details of Ukrainian architecture turned out to be hidden by the features of modernism." It has to be said about high-quality construction works - street terazzo facades and brick masonry in the yard, mosaic stairs and stairwells with massive fences of strict pattern, painted doors imitating the stained oak. The building is listed as an architectural monument of local significance (protection number №12, 30.04.1980). Denis Vitchenko
